    Herring Cove Provincial Park sits on Campobello Island and is a scenic, peaceful coastal park with a long cobble-and-sand beach, forest trails, and dramatic Bay of Fundy scenery. At low tide, the strong tides pull back to reveal tide pools and exposed rock shelves. The park also has a small campground, picnic areas, and short forest trails that climb into the hills above the cove for elevated views. Seabirds, shorebirds, and seals call this park home.

    The Rock of Gibraltar Trail & Herring Cove Beach loop in Herring Cove Provincial Park offers a delightful mix of coastal and forest scenery. You'll wander along a scenic pebble-and-sand beach, hear the unique sound of rocks rolling with the Bay of Fundy tides, and explore old-growth spruce forests. The trail's namesake, the massive Rock of Gibraltar, is a striking glacial erratic that makes for a memorable landmark along the way.

    This easy 3.1-mile (5.0 km) loop with only 41 feet (12 metres) of elevation gain is perfect for a leisurely hike, taking about 1 hour and 15 minutes to complete. Parking is available at Herring Cove Provincial Park, and the trail is well-maintained, making it an excellent choice for families or those looking for a gentle stroll. Consider visiting during low tide to explore the exposed tide pools.

    Beyond its natural beauty, the park holds historical significance, with trails once frequented by the Roosevelts. It's also a nature reserve, offering opportunities to spot marine birds like Common Eiders and cormorants, and occasionally White-tailed Deer. This trail provides a fantastic introduction to the dynamic coastlines and rich biodiversity of Campobello Island.
